  • QUICK USA, Inc. is a Japanese job agency with offices in major US cities, committed to supporting job seekers from diverse backgrounds and industries. Services include career counseling, interview preparation, and job placement.

  • Takeshi Yamagishi is a dedicated career consultant whose life took a significant turn during his middle school days in Ishikawa-ken after a transformative encounter with a JET Program ALT at his school. Takeshi went onto become a JTE and worked with JET ALTs in the Japanese public school system. His career eventually changed course and he now works with Quick USA and lives in Dallas, TX with his family.

    Inspired and impacted by his interactions with JET Program participants, Takeshi is on a mission to give back to the JET community by offering complimentary career support to JET alumni through USJETAA. (These consultations are intended for registered USJETAA members. Free & supporting memberships are available.) Takeshi has successfully supported many JET alumni to help them understand the various Japan-related job markets and industry landscapes, guiding them towards career opportunities that fit their interests. He also understands that most JETs have Japanese language and cultural competencies that are highly valued by Japanese companies.

  • Carlos Medina (Oita, 2019-2022) was an elementary and middle school ALT in Oita. Following his tenure on the JET Program, he spent a year in the hotel industry in Japan after which he decided to make his way home to Dallas, TX where he currently resides and works as a Sales/Recruiter/Project Assistant for Quick USA.

    As a member of Quick USA, he is fulfilling his desire to be a bridge between the US and Japan. Carlos understands the challenge of returning home from JET and hopes to support fellow alumni in finding a position based on their interests and aligning them with the right company.

  • Pasona NA is an HR business partner for Japanese companies with over 15 branches worldwide. We are the largest Japanese specific recruitment company in the US. Our goal is to provide job seekers with personalized consultation and advice both for their job search and future career growth.

  • Laura Tanaka has had a dream of uniting Japan and America for the past 10 years. She first moved to Japan in 2017 on the JET Programme and was placed in Osaka, upon graduating of JET in 2020, she worked at a small Japanese company doing international sales, and then launched her own English business in 2021. She returned to the states in 2022 and started working at Pasona NA. She has continued to work towards her goal and managed several international projects resulting in the onboarding of bilingual Americans who are interested in working with Japanese companies.

    She enjoys bridging the cultural gap within companies and helping JET Alumni realize their full professional potential. Contact her for resume updates, career coaching, and professional support.
